Description: Nav4All is an open-source, customizable navigation software designed specifically for people with visual, cognitive and mobility impairments. It provides audio and tactile guidance to make navigating unfamiliar environments easier and safer.

Description: Waze is a community-based GPS navigation app that provides real-time traffic and road info based on crowd sourced data. Users report accidents, police, hazards, etc. to alert other drivers.

Cons
  • Drains phone battery
  • Potential privacy concerns
  • Relies on user reports (not 100% comprehensive)
  • Can suggest unsafe/illegal routes to save time
